GS vs. West Virginia University Tech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, GS or West Virginia University Tech?

  • West Virginia University Institute of Technology is 79.5% more expensive to attend than GS for in-state tuition ($7,848.00 vs. $4,371.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 27% higher at West Virginia University Tech than Georgia Southern University ($19,584.00 vs. $15,425.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at West Virginia University Institute of Technology than GS ($9,529 vs. $15,352)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Georgia Southern University are 13.2% lower than costs at West Virginia University Institute of Technology ($10,316 vs. $11,676)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at West Virginia University Institute of Technology than Georgia Southern University (99% vs. 95%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by West Virginia University Institute of Technology students is 0.3% larger than aid received Georgia Southern University ($8,830 vs. $8,806)

GS vs. West Virginia University Tech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, GS or West Virginia University Tech?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between West Virginia University Tech or GS .

  • The average SAT score at Georgia Southern University (1089) is 107 points higher than at West Virginia University Tech (982)
  • Incoming GS students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(23) than students at West Virginia University Tech (21)
  • Accepted freshman West Virginia University Tech students have a 0.15 point higher average high school GPA (3.51) than students at GS (3.36)
  • GS has a higher acceptance rate (88.9%) than West Virginia University Tech (64.6%)

GS vs. West Virginia University Tech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, GS or West Virginia University Tech?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between West Virginia University Tech and GS.

  • The graduation rate at GS is higher than West Virginia University Institute of Technology (47% vs. 29%)
  • Graduates from West Virginia University Institute of Technology earn on average $5,800 more per year than GS graduates after ten years. ($50,600 vs. $44,800)
  • Georgia Southern University students graduate with a $1,001 lower median federal student loan debt than West Virginia University Tech graduates. ($23,000 vs. $24,001)
  • GS graduates are paying $11 less per month on federal student loans than West Virginia University Tech graduates. ($237 vs. $248)
  • More West Virginia University Tech gra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former GS students, three years after graduation. (59% vs. 52%)
